To all residents of the European Union

Important environmental information about this product

This symbol on the device or the package indicates that disposal of the device after its

lifecycle could harm the environment.
Do not dispose of the unit (or batteries) as unsorted municipal waste; it should be taken to a

specialized company for recycling.

This device should be returned to your distributor or to a local recycling service.

Respect the local environmental rules.

If in doubt, contact your local waste disposal authorities.

2. Use

Turn the rotary switch fully clockwise to test the strength of a battery. The battery LED will light bright
green if the internal battery is fully charged.


Plug one end of the cable into the appropriate jack on the left side of your VTTEST15. Plug the other

end of the cable into the appropriate jack on the right. Now, set the rotary switch to “1” to test the
connection of contact “1” on the plug inserted into the left. If there is a connection, the green LED will

light below “1” while a yellow LED will light above the contact of the plug connected to the right. If no
LED lights, there is no connection: the left connection will either be floating or open. Set the rotary

switch to “2” to test contact “2” etc. until all contacts have been checked. If the GROUND LED lights,
there is a connection between the corresponding contacts and the chassis.


To test a cable with banana plugs, just plug each end of the cable into the banana jacks. The LED will

light and the unit will beep if there is a connection between the plugs. These jacks can also be used for
continuity tests using two probe leads.
